Senior Software Engineer
Job description:
We are currently looking for a consultant to start working with our current client's platform development project. In this project you would be a part of project team that is developing a cross platform engine in C+ - that powers data-intensive feature development (ML, algorithms and others) Development of tools to support developers, data scientists and other stakeholders make use of said platform. You would be developing the platform as a whole but also supporting the development of core (non-UI) Swift and/or Kotlin components and migrating code from platform-specific implementations to the shared C+ - core. In general we are especially looking for someone who would have wide understanding of technologies and tools, pragmatic approach and mindset of creating scalable solutions is something that we are looking for this project. If you have previous expertise working with data and ML tools (eg. Python based tools especially) it is an advantage. C+ - would be the main tech for the platform, so understanding of that is essential (or high willingness to learn that - expertise with similar techs). Project would start would be as soon as possible, but we are definitely looking for **the right person** here! Project would be a long-term development project with 100% allocation (possibility to adjust of course with flexible working hours). Client has offices in Helsinki and Oulu but they are working in a hybrid mode in general (fully remote working outside Finland is not possible). Working language is English. More info via slack / Karoliina.heikkila@witted.com.